A message for families in the community from Ms. Stacy Stone.
Good Day, With summer approaching and the kids starting to walk around the community more, it was discussed to share this informational piece as a reminder to the parents to talk to their children about not touching items they find on the streets. Fentanyl is growing rapidly in our community and it is unknown where or what item(s) in the ditches are exposed too. Also, I know the Community Health Department and the Prevention Program will be reaching out to the school about doing some prevention activities surrounding contraband (needles, wrappers, etc..) that are found within the community park and recreational areas.
